Make sure you call Ford Customer Care rather than your dealer, I ordered on 8/26 and never heard anything and called in November and found out the options I chose were “not a compatible build” and found out since I had not selected to delete the smart hitch and scales they wouldn’t complete my build until it became available (if it ever does) so I had to modify my order to remove that option and received a build date two weeks later.

We think our dealer's lack of knowing to delete the bed scale and smart hitch option also caused our order to go on hold, and going down on the wait-list. Probably resulted in us losing the $7500 tax rebate for a November or December delivery. Got our build date in February.
